As I get older, I realize that many of my
most painful moments, could now,
in retrospect, be considered blessings
in disguise. Since such a determination
requires hindsight, we must muddle
through. In the end, as the note conveys,
our best strategy may be to repeat our
affirmative prayers, step back, and then,
let it be.
DISGUISED BLESSING
A blessing in disguise is often hard
to fathom, especially when the consequences
or circumstances present no clear
distinction – when our desires appear
thwarted, our hopes dashed, plans stalled,
our dreams set asunder.
There we often sit transfixed –waiting and
wondering why fate, Providence, or possibly,
just bad luck – has ransacked our future,
leaving us bewildered and uninspired.
As we resist the advice to “see the good in it,”
or “through the veiled disguise,” perhaps
consider a moratorium, suspending speculation
or halfhearted effort, taking the time to refocus,
reframe, and repeat our original prayerful
incantation, then stepping back with expectation,
belief, and let it be.
